What causes fence posts to lean in Skokie, and how can you fix them?

Leaning fence posts are often caused by freeze-thaw cycles shifting the soil, or by rot at the base from moisture trapped by mulch or grass. Quality First Painting can reset and brace the post using concrete anchors or gravel backfill, then replace rotted sections with new pressure-treated lumber. For long-term stability, we recommend setting posts below the frost line and sealing the wood to prevent moisture damage.

My fence panels were damaged by high winds last night. What are the signs that I need a full replacement versus a repair?

Signs that a panel can be repaired include isolated cracks, loose pickets, or a single broken rail. If the posts are intact and the panel is still square, we can sister new wood or secure fasteners. If the posts are leaning, the panel is racked, or rot has spread into adjacent sections, a full panel replacement is usually faster and more cost-effective. Our team will inspect the whole run to give you an honest assessment.

Does pressure washing help prevent fence damage, and when should I schedule it?

Yes, regular pressure washing removes built-up dirt, mildew, and algae that trap moisture against the wood. This slows rot and helps paint or stain adhere better. We recommend washing fences in early spring after the snow melts and again in late fall before winter sets in. Quality First Painting uses a low-pressure, wide-fan nozzle to avoid damaging the wood fibers. It's a simple way to extend your fence's life.
